The Houston Baptist Huskies men's basketball statistical leaders are individual statistical leaders of the Houston Baptist Huskies men's basketball program in various categories, including points , rebounds , assists , steals , and blocks . Within those areas, the lists identify single-game, single-season, and career leaders. The Huskies represent the Houston Baptist University in the NCAA 's Southland Conference .[1]
Houston Baptist began competing in intercollegiate basketball in 1963. The NCAA did not officially record assists as a stat until the 1983–84 season, and blocks and steals until the 1985–86 season, but Houston's record books includes players in these stats before these seasons.[2] These lists are updated through the end of the 2020–21 season.
